PM Shri Narendra Modi praised 6 billion UPI transactions in July

Published on

New Delhi: The Prime Minister, Shri Narendra Modi has praised the outstanding accomplishment of 6 billion UPI transactions in July, the highest ever since 2016.

In a response to a tweet by Union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man, the Prime Minister said; “This is an outstanding accomplishment. It indicates the collective resolve of the people of India to embrace new technologies and make the economy cleaner. Digital payments were particularly helpful during the COVID-19 pandemic.”
